Jack glanced over to the small door, hoping that Gilbert and Samantha had already left the warehouse compound. To his dismay, they were still behind the mace. It vibrated with a transparent light that created a force field preventing the two from reaching the door.

'What kind of skill is that? Is the Priest a melee fighter or a magic-user?!' Jack screamed in frustration in his mind.

'He is a melee fighter, most likely something of a hybrid between an inquisitor and monk class,' Peniel's voice came to explain. 'That force field thing is most likely the mace's weapon skill.'

Jack hadn't really been asking for an explanation; he had just been expressing his frustration. But he asked Peniel, 'Do you have any idea how we can get out of this situation?'

'Nope,' she answered flatly.

Jack was about to curse and tell her how useless she was, but managed to stop before he formed the words. He remembered that the Fairy heard everything he uttered in his mind.

Left with no choice, he decided to fight with everything he had in order to buy time. He just hoped that the force field from the mace had a time limit. He aimed his staff and sent several standard range attacks at the Priest. The priest dodged them all with ease as he leisurely walked towards Jack, toying with the mouse.

Jack knew the Priest's speed was overwhelming; he would only have one chance while his opponent still underestimated him. Jack focused all his attention on the Priest's movements as he continued to send range attacks towards him.

When his Mana Bullet came off cooldown, he cast it. The Bullet again passed by the Priest's body as he vanished. This is it! Jack thought. He didn't know if the Priest would come at him from the left or right, but he was pretty certain the Priest wouldn't waste time circling to his back. He wouldn't consider it necessary against such an easy opponent. Hence Jack jumped back the moment he noticed the Priest's sudden disappearance.

As he jumped back, a shadow swiftly swept by from his left. The Priest's fist swung on a low line. He was repeating his attacks from before. Jack didn't have time to scoff at his opponent's lack of creativity; he kicked the ground to launch himself forward.

The Priest showed surprise when he realized his prey had escaped his attack, but he regained his mocking grin when he saw the prey coming back towards him. 'Like a moth to a lamp,' he thought. He saw Jack swing his sword towards him. He could have easily evaded the attack, but he confidently chose to lift his hand up instead.

He was planning to slap the sword away before delivering another series of punches to his prey. But before the sword reached his hand, it broke apart. He was confused by this turn of events. Did the sword's durability run out? But if so, it should have broken when it hit his hand, not before. Then he felt a surge of power from the sword as it emitted golden light from its center. It was too late for him to dodge anymore. When the sword slammed onto his hand, he felt hot pain burn from his hand to his entire body.

Jack's Overlimit skill managed to break through the Priest's iron-like defense. Jack had combined the attack with his Power Strike skill. It cut a gash in the Priest's arm, spewing a line of blood. Though the slash only hit the arm, his opponent lost 196 damage.

The Priest was so shocked by the sudden increase of his opponent's power that he failed to dodge the second attack. This was only a normal slash, but it still scored 105 damage. Not planning to waste the opportunity, Jack followed with a third slash. But this time, the Priest had come back to his senses and no longer allowed Jack to attack him freely. Jack's third slash hit empty air as the Priest circled to his back.

Jack was aware his opponent was behind him but his reaction was not fast enough. He was punched hard on his back. He stumbled forward and made a roundhouse slash, but it still hit nothing but air. The Priest's fist then jabbed at his face. Jack swayed backward, trying hard to keep his balance as he executed Swing, hoping the large area skill would strike his opponent. But he still hit nothing.

Jack had cast Magic Shield but the Priest's punches came from unexpected angles. The Priest was starting to take him seriously after being injured twice. Jack's Overlimit skill was rendered useless as he could not make contact with his opponent.

Jack felt another hard punch to his chest. It sent him flying to where Gilbert and Samantha were. He fell to the ground; his HP was in a critical state. He would not survive another two punches. The force field was still there; they couldn't pass through.

He could see the mocking faces of the Acolytes watching from a distance, and heard the relaxed footsteps of the Priest slowly approaching. He would lose his life and still fail to complete the mission. It was depressing.

"Screw it!" Jack cursed as he rose to his feet again. He was just going to lose 50% experience anyway, he would try to deal as much damage as he could with the remaining health that he had.

As he thought all hope was lost, he saw the Priest's eyes go wide and his expression turn grim.

Jack heard a screeching sound from his back. He turned and saw Gilbert enveloped in a blood-red aura!

Gilbert had his arm stretched out, and, somehow, he was drilling through the force field around the mace. His hand was just an inch away from the mace's shaft.

"Are you insane?" the Priest yelled. "You know you don't have much life left; you will burn through it if you use that Life Burning Art again!"

"Better than letting you slaughter us," Gilbert replied with a resolute face.

His hand grabbed onto the mace and the force field shattered. He pulled the mace out of the ground. The force tore the earth and threw dirt all over the place. A large hole was left where the mace had been embedded. Gilbert brandished the mace and rushed past Jack in the shape of a red glowing ball. The red ball of energy slammed onto the Priest and exploded. The impact sent the Priest flying to the other side of the warehouse's outer yard.

Gilbert then swept his hand in a horizontal arc; it created a shockwave that pushed away all the Acolytes who were watching, stunned by what they had just witnessed.

"Go!" Gilbert shouted to Jack and Samantha.

Jack didn't waste any time, he picked up Samantha and carried her while he ran to the fence's small door. When he opened the door, he glanced to the side and saw Gilbert throw the mace towards the Priest who was just getting back up on his feet. The Priest tried to use both hands to catch his weapon, but instead, he was pushed back even further by the force of the throw.  He slammed onto the far away fence on the other side. Gilbert turned back and ran to them as Jack went out the door.

They made it to the street that Jack had come down before. Jack was just about to run towards the direction of the Business district, but Gilbert called to him, "No! This way!"

Jack stopped and turned to follow Gilbert. The old man was still enveloped by the same red aura. He looked completely different. Before, he was like an exhausted man who was having trouble with his age, now he seemed to be as fit as a tiger. As they ran away from the warehouse, he saw on his radar that red dots were coming after them. He glanced back and saw the Acolytes rushing out of the warehouse.

"This way!" Gilbert shouted.

Jack still carried Samantha so he and Gilbert could run at full speed. He turned the corner where Gilbert had gone. They weaved through several complex alleyways around the slum. Gilbert was very familiar with the layout of the slum; he kept on making turns to throw their pursuers off their scent. There were even two occasions where they went through doors and passed through empty dwellings.

Although the Cult had many members, they were having a hard time trying to catch them.. Just in case the Cultists managed to find them during their escape, Jack ate the remaining Bread and Junk food, left over from the Tutorial period, to recover his critical health.
